An additional commonly recognized connector in the RF globe is the BNC RF connector, which is often made use of in both consumer-grade and specialist applications. BNC connectors are known for their bayonet securing mechanism, which supplies a secure connection that can be conveniently connected and detached. These qualities make the BNC connector a favored selection in laboratory setups, broadcasting, and also in test equipment. In high-frequency applications, the 2.4 mm RF connector provides a distinct balance of size and performance. These small connectors are made to execute effectively at frequencies beyond 40 GHz, providing to sophisticated telecommunications and measurement tools. The special style of the 2.4 mm connector minimizes insertion loss, making it ideal for applications that need high signal accuracy. SMA RF termination loads are vital elements in RF screening and dimension arrangements, acting as a means to avoid reflections in an RF system when the check here signal path is not connected to a device. These loads are essential for maintaining the integrity of RF signals and minimizing prospective damage to devices due to shown power.
